    Chinalco not considering Fortescue buy

    Shares in Fortescue Metals Group (FMG) have plunged, after the Chinese state-owned company Chinalco reportedly said it is not looking at buying the Western Australian-based company.


    Chinalco reportedly says it is not considering any iron ore projects and is more likely to return its focus to base metals, such as copper and aluminium.


    FMG shares are down almost 10 per cent at $3.67.


    Meanwhile, Fortescue is also looking at building a port with Perth-based miner Aquila Resources at Anketell Point in the Pilbara.


    They will share information to determine whether the move would cut costs.


    Aquila says the site has the potential to export up to 350 million tonnes a year of iron ore.
